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
176 750410 434380 7582933
83012 33032725 433695979
83012 33032725 433695979
1221118088 0959 8301 83564868
All about undefined
Interested in learning more?
83012 33032725 433695979
1221118088 0959 8301 83564868
See more
1419 634453 95537164658
101 5977 66 12725764
See more
2947 92990265 798736
47 4452160 2116
See more